Problem at scale

UDOT's 14-year-old, homegrown client-server system had reached the end of its life and could no longer support the agency's needs. Accessible only within the state's firewall or via Citrix, it created significant friction for UDOT's construction contracting community and left teams buried in paper trails. UDOT needed a modern SaaS replacement that could integrate with existing systems and support field operations at scale.

  • Outdated client-server architecture required users to be inside the state firewall or use a Citrix connection, limiting access for contractors and consultants.
  • The legacy system could no longer support field data collection, cost, schedule, and contract management at the required scale.
  • New modules had to replace select PDBS components while integrating with web-based bidding, civil rights, and certified payroll systems.
  • Disorganized processes and paper-based workflows slowed down operations across UDOT, its consultants, and its contractors.

Aurigo's approach

Aurigo was selected through a competitive RFP process for its modern SaaS technology, breadth of functionality, and ease of use. UDOT has fully implemented Construction Project Management, Contract Management, and Materials Management, and is rolling out Estimation & Bidding and Civil Rights products. With over 3,000 users on the platform, Aurigo has unified UDOT's business processes, maintaining the integrity of project costs, schedules, budgets, and timelines while driving collaboration, productivity, and accuracy across the agency.

  • Construction Project Management, Contract Management, and Materials Management were fully implemented across the agency.
  • Estimation & Bidding and Civil Rights products are actively being rolled out.
  • Field staff and project teams access the platform via browser or mobile device in online and offline modes.
  • Field inspectors capture and upload site photos directly to field reports in real time via the Masterworks mobile app.
  • GPS-enabled devices automatically capture and upload location coordinates to the server.
  • Unified platform has reduced margin of error, enhanced work quality, and improved collaboration across business units.
